Sandra Harrington, age 79, of Carver, formerly of Plymouth, died Tuesday, May 29, 2018, at her home following a brief illness. She was the wife of the late Jerald P. Harrington and the daughter of the late Raymond and Dorothy Clark (Lloyd). Born and raised in Wilton, Maine, Sandra moved with her husband to Plymouth in 1963 to raise their family and later to Carver in 1977. She worked as a mechanical illustrator for Northeast Airlines and a telephone operator for New England Telephone Company. She enjoyed being with family and friends, antiquing, ceramics, cooking, traveling, participating in bingo and bunco, and trying her hand at the local casinos. She is survived by her children Keith Harrington and his wife Tina of Linneus, Maine, Beth Thomas and her husband William of Corydon, Indiana, and Kent Harrington and his wife Deborah of Carver, Massachusetts; grandchildren Brittany and Brandon Harrington; Tyler(Alexis), Darcey, Benjamin, Hunter and the late Morgan Thomas; Cole, Sydney and Bradley Harrington; and great grandchildren Ondine Beaton, Aurora and Lucas Harrington; and Beau, Carter, and Grace Thomas. She was the sister of the late Nelson Barrie Clark, Evelyn Dutil, Edna Allen, Lloyd Scott Clark, David and Conrad Hugh Clark and is survived by Karen Downing. Her funeral will be held in the Davis Funeral Home, 373 Court Street, Plymouth, MA on Wednesday at 9 am , followed by interment Plymouth County Cemetery, Plymouth.
